Saturday’s racing across Caulfield and Randwick saw some massive wins by several horses.
From Sir Delius winning his first Group 1 to Birdman edging out Adelaide River, the day had plenty of fantastic stories.
See the top five wins from Saturday below:
Sir Delius has now firmly established himself as the Melbourne Cup favourite, winning the Group 1 Underwood Stakes (1800m) in impressive fashion.
The Gai Waterhouse and Adrian Bott trained bay flew home at the 400m mark and denied Buckaroo from winning back-to-back Underwood Stakes.
Half Yours won the Group 3 Naturalism Stakes (2000m), establishing himself as a real Caulfield Cup threat.
At the 200m Half Yours bolted home, proving he has what it takes to win the 2400m Caulfield Cup.
At the 800m Joliestar was in last place, but the backmarker flew home in incredible fashion.

Sepals proved once again why it's a 1400m extraordinaire.
The four-year-old is unbeaten at the distance and it is now a Group 1 winner.

In an exceptional display of grit, Birdman and Adelaide River were in a class of their own, battling one another for the Group 3 Kingston Town Stakes (2000m).
Birdman narrowly beat Adelaide River in a photo finish.
